Best and Shortest IELTS Exam Tips

Without further ado, below are a few of the most useful and shortest IELTS study guide tips:

Writing – For that writing part of the IELTS, use bullet points to pre-structure your essay. Give your bullet points work as your framework. In this way, you can organize your thinking, anchor your ideas, and make a flowing essay that reads well.

Listening – You may be surprised nevertheless the easiest reaction you can have to boost your IELTS listening score is actually watching subtitled English movies. By watching subtitled English movies, you practice your English reading and comprehension skills.

Reading – To boost your reading comprehension score, it’s important that you simply figure out how to skim a page. Locate keywords through the IELTS questions and focus on those when you read the paragraph. You may not understand each and every word of the paragraph but by emphasizing the keywords, you stand an enhanced likelihood of answering the question correctly.
